The Minnesota State Fair is currently underway and one of the most popular food items being offered is deep-fried ranch, which is served at Lulu’s Public House. The dish has attracted lines hundreds of people long, as fairgoers are either curious or eager to try the unique and buzzworthy fair food. Described by the fair as ranch dressing filling made with ranch seasoning, buttermilk, and cream cheese in a panko shell, deep-fried ranch is also dusted with ranch powder and served with a hot honey sauce made with Cry Baby Craig’s hot sauce. According to a sign at Lulu’s Public House, the dish is made with Hidden Valley Ranch and ranch flavorings.

Charlie Burrows, co-owner of Lulu’s, explained that Minnesotans have a particular affinity for ranch dressing, often requesting it as a side with most dishes. Burrows worked on the concept of deep-fried ranch for over a year and a half before debuting it at the fair. Despite the unconventional nature of the dish, Burrows was confident people would enjoy it and expressed his excitement about its debut. Just two days after the fair opened, he had to increase his order by 150% due to the overwhelming demand for the deep-fried ranch.

Celebrities and politicians visiting the fair have also tried and enjoyed the deep-fried ranch. Olympic gymnast Suni Lee sampled it during her fair visit, expressing her surprise and enjoyment. Country singer Blake Shelton also praised the dish during his concert at the fairgrounds, declaring it to be delicious. Senator Tina Smith of Minnesota, who has previously referred to ranch as a sacred condiment of the Midwest, also tried the deep-fried ranch and approved, noting the hot honey sauce as a standout component of the dish.
